I need a new operator for a Anderson casement window CSW -5, right-side, locks on left. Made in Jan 1980. I know its a straight 9" (estimate)arm. It looks like part number 39-095 is the correct one. Could you verify for me and confirm before I order? Thank you

Dave Sr. from SWISCO responded:
You would need to remove the operator from your window to be sure of which replacement would work. I can only see so much based on these pictures. Take a look at our video on how to replace a casement window operator below, that would give you some idea on how to remove yours.
